It's 1971 and my girlfriend (now my wife) needed a new car that was cheap but as reliable as possible with nice features. We looked at the Vega. Rubber floor mats, taxi-cab plaid interior and a 2-spd auto. Then we looked at a Pinto. Carpets, nice vinyl buckets and a 3-spd auto, and more horsepower, all for less money. I couldn't have been a more dedicated Chevy guy at the time, but I had to pick the Pinto for her. It held up for over 100Kmi and the only real maintenance was to replace the cam and followers (a known wear issue with those cars). I think the winner will be an AMC product.
